Cool Things to Do This Christmas in Kuala Lumpur: A Complete Festive Guide

Christmas transforms Kuala Lumpur into a dazzling celebration of lights, markets, performances, and family activities. As Malaysia's capital, the city offers diverse festive experiences spanning luxury mall spectacles, artisanal markets, workshops, dining celebrations, and interactive attractions. This guide explores the best Christmas activities across the Klang Valley for the 2025 season.​

Must-See Christmas Decorations & Photo Spots

1. Pavilion Kuala Lumpur — The Luxury Icon

Pavilion KL remains the undisputed champion of KL's Christmas displays, featuring the city's most elaborate decorations, luxury brand collaborations, and Instagram-worthy installations.​

2025 Decorations Highlights:

  • "Christmas Love & Magic" Theme: Suspended Christmas tree decked in yellow, white, and metallic accents creating a celestial holiday atmosphere​

  • Dior's Golden Tree: Luxury collaboration featuring Dior's branded carriage and golden tree installation at the main entrance—described as "like walking into a perfume ad."​

  • Carousel & Sleigh Installations: Classic-meets-modern aesthetic combining traditional holiday imagery with contemporary artistry​

  • Cascading Twinkling Lights: Waterfall-style ceiling lights create perfect golden-hour photography opportunities without filters​

  • Scale: 30-foot installations and elaborate centerpieces reflecting world-class retail standards​

This venue epitomizes luxury Christmas—expect glamorous aesthetics, high-end shopping, premium dining, and fashion-forward holiday ambiance. The decorations refresh regularly, offering multiple visits throughout the season.​

Arrive early (before 11:00 AM on weekdays) to beat crowds and capture photos before peak afternoon traffic. The carousel and suspended tree areas are most popular for social media content.​

Pavilion's comprehensive food court and fine dining options support extended visits without leaving the mall.​

2. Suria KLCC — Malaysia's First Outdoor Festive Skating Rink

Suria KLCC introduces the Klang Valley's major new attraction: Malaysia's first-ever outdoor festive skating rink, operating from November 26–December 25.​

Skating Rink Details:

Timing: 11:30 AM–9:30 PM daily​

Experience: Iconic Petronas Twin Towers backdrop creates a magical skating atmosphere with professional-grade ice quality​

Skill Levels: Welcome both experienced skaters and beginners through progressive instruction​

Rental Equipment: On-site skate rentals available​

Additional Attractions:

  • Magical Music Box: Interactive installation creating immersive musical experience​

  • Mirror Room: Infinity mirror installation offering trippy photo opportunities​

  • Festive Photobooth: Professional photography services capturing holiday memories​

  • Christmas Caroling: Free performances on Nov 30, Dec 7, 14, 21, 25​

  • Centre Court Display: Signature centre-court Christmas decorations combining classic festive elements with innovative tech​

This venue appeals to active families, photography enthusiasts, and those seeking nostalgic winter activities in a tropical setting. The outdoor skating rink transforms KL's perpetual summer into a temperate Christmas experience.​

The skating rink draws heavy crowds on weekends; weekday early-morning sessions (11:30 AM start) offer superior experiences with minimal queuing.​

3. LaLaport BBCC (Bukit Bintang City Centre) — Rooftop Garden Festivity

LaLaport's Level 4 rooftop garden transforms into a white Christmas wonderland, complete with snow sessions and comprehensive holiday programming.​

"Lesgo Ready 4 X'MAS" Event Features:

  • White Christmas Experience: Without traveling to the highlands, the rooftop garden creates a white Christmas ambiance​

  • Snow Sessions: Nine snow-generating sessions nightly (Friday–Sunday and holidays, including Christmas & NYE) from 7:30 PM–11:30 PM at 30-minute intervals​

  • Live Performances: Continuous musical performances throughout the evening​

  • Festive Food Bazaar: Diverse food vendors offering holiday treats and traditional Christmas fare​

  • Creative Workshops: Hands-on crafting activities (dates vary)​

  • Christmas Tree Garden: Festive photo opportunities among decorated garden installations​

  • Admission: FREE​

LaLaport's rooftop concept offers a sophisticated urban gardening ambiance alongside playful snow sessions. The free admission and comprehensive entertainment make it accessible to all budget levels.​

Weekend evenings (7:30 PM onwards) experience peak snow sessions and live performance energy; weekday evenings offer a more relaxed atmosphere.​

4. Mid Valley Megamall — Santa's Academy Craft Wonderland

Mid Valley's "Santa's Academy" theme creates an immersive storybook experience with playful, colorful decorations specifically designed for families and children.​

Interactive Workshops & Activities:

  • Santa's Academy Workshop Training

  • Candy Cane Cord Assembly

  • Santa's Pink Tree Project

  • Elf Headwear Class

  • Sleigh Ready Headband Design

  • North Pole Music Box Assembly

  • Santa Certification Class

  • Merry Munchies Decor Class

  • Melvita Mist Workshop

Each corner of the mall represents a different holiday mission—assembling decorations, crafting ornaments, and completing Santa-themed challenges. The hands-on, activity-rich environment sustains engagement across multiple hours.​

Being a megamall, Mid Valley offers expansive space accommodating large family groups without overcrowding sensations. The diverse workshop schedule ensures activities align with various age groups and interests.​

Premium Christmas Dining Experiences

Hotel Restaurant Christmas Dinners

Multiple luxury hotels offer specially curated Christmas dinners with festive menus, premium service, and celebratory atmospheres.​

Notable Options Include:

  • Fine Dining Buffets: Featuring turkey, seafood on ice, specialty roasts, and international selections

  • À la Carte Menus: Chef-curated courses celebrating seasonal ingredients

  • Festive Beverages: Champagne, mulled wine, and signature Christmas cocktails

  • Live Entertainment: Piano performances, jazz trios, and festive caroling

Special Seating: Rooftop or window positions offering city skyline views

Pricing: From RM200–RM500+ per person, depending on restaurant tier and menu selection

Booking Requirement: Essential—premium restaurants book solid 2–4 weeks in advance. Ensure reservations well before mid-December.​

Festive Markets & Shopping

1. Lot 10 Christmas Market — Extended Season Celebration

Lot 10 offers both indoor and outdoor Christmas markets with extensive dates and curated local vendor selections.​

Market Details:

  • Indoor Pop-up: November 17, 2025 – January 4, 2026 (extended through post-Christmas)​

  • Outdoor Market: November 24 – December 21​

  • Timing: 10:00 AM – 10:00 PM both venues​

  • Vendor Count: Over 60 local vendors​

  • Product Categories: Unique gifts, artisanal crafts, handmade ornaments, locally-designed fashion, home decor​

Lot 10's dual-venue approach accommodates different shopping preferences—covered indoor shopping for weather protection, outdoor market ambiance for festive street-level energy.​

The extended indoor market (through January 4) accommodates late-season gift shopping and post-Christmas browsing without vendor closures.​

2. Bangsar Shopping Centre — Handcrafted Elegance

Bangsar Shopping Centre emphasizes artisanal, neighborhood-focused celebration with soft lighting and boutique market aesthetic.​

Workshop Highlights:

  • Christmas Ball Light Workshop: Nov 29​

  • The Winter String Quartet Performance: Nov 30​

  • Holly Jolly Ornaments Workshop: Dec 6​

  • Santa Meet & Greet: Dec 6, 13, 21​

  • Cardboard Gingerbread House: Dec 7​

  • Stained Glass Workshop: Dec 20​

  • Jingle Ball Ornaments Workshop: Dec 21​

Warm, handcrafted theme with soft lighting creates an intimate celebration atmosphere appealing to those seeking a boutique shopping experience over commercial mall energy.​

3. Kozie Christmas Market — One-Day Workshop Spectacular

Kozie Christmas Market offers a concentrated, single-day event at Jumpa KL (Jalan Ipoh) emphasizing DIY workshops and community engagement.​

Event Focus: Workshops galore across various craft disciplines​

Timing: One-day event (specific dates vary annually)​

Ideal for those seeking intensive, focused market experience rather than extended mall browsing. The single-day format creates concentrated festive energy.​

Family-Friendly Activities

1. CoComelon Adventure at Quayside Mall

Quayside Mall features the "Jolly Christmas Adventure featuring CoComelon" with activities specifically designed for young families.​

Activities Include:

  • Meet & Greet with Dance Along: Interactive experience with CoComelon characters​

  • Art & Craft Workshops: Child-friendly creative sessions​

  • Moonbug Cinema Screenings: Family-appropriate movie selections​

  • Sing-Along Christmas Performances: Participatory musical entertainment​

  • Let It Snow: Special snowfall effects (weekends/public holidays)​

  • Santa Bear Walkabout: Character appearances for photo opportunities​

Specifically targets families with young children through character-aligned activities and age-appropriate entertainment.​

2. Snoopy & Friends Meet & Greet at Pavilion Bukit Jalil

December 24 (10:00 AM–6:00 PM) features Charlie, Snoopy, and Lucy character meet-and-greets.​

Details: RM50 per person (photo and character interaction)​

Beloved cartoon character experiences creating nostalgic family moments.​

3. Nutcracker Performances & Walkabouts

Multiple malls host traditional Nutcracker-themed performances, marching bands, and character walkabouts.​

Typical Programming:

  • Nutcracker Marching Band Performances

  • Giant Nutcracker Character Walkabouts

  • Christmas Fairy Character Encounters

Times: Various malls, typically 4:00 PM performances​

Admission: FREE​

Interactive & Creative Workshops

DIY Christmas Craft Sessions

Most major malls offer hands-on workshops across varied skill levels and age groups:

Wreath Decorating: Suria KLCC (Dec 25, 3:00–4:00 PM, FREE)​

Ornament Making: Sunway Velocity (multiple dates)​

Gingerbread House Assembly: Mid Valley (cardboard versions for families)​

Candle Making: Bangsar Shopping Centre​

Stained Glass Ornament Creation: Bangsar Shopping Centre (Dec 20)​

Registration: Most workshops require pre-registration or early arrival for limited spots. Check individual mall websites for current registration protocols.​

Themed Experience Venues

1. Genting SkyWorlds Theme Park — Holiday Special Programming

Operating Friday–Sunday and public holidays (including Christmas) with snow sessions.​

Holiday Features:

Nine Snow Sessions Nightly: 7:30 PM–11:30 PM at 30-minute intervals​

Festive Park Atmosphere: Holiday decorations, lighting, and entertainment across theme park​

Ride Access: Standard park admission includes all rides plus snow sessions​

Location: Genting Highlands (approximately 1 hour from KL city center)​

Best For: Families combining theme park thrills with seasonal festivity; those seeking extended entertainment beyond mall-based activities.​

Top Recommendations by Preference

For Luxury Shopping & Photo Moments: Pavilion KL's "Christmas Love & Magic" theme offers unmatched glitz, designer collaborations, and Instagram-worthy installations. Plan for 3–4 hours to fully experience the decorations and shopping.​

For Active Family Experiences: Suria KLCC's outdoor skating rink (Malaysia's first) combined with carousel installations and interactive displays, creates multi-sensory engagement. Budget 2–3 hours, including skating time.​

For Artisanal Discovery: Lot 10's extended market (through January 4) and Bangsar Shopping Centre's handcrafted focus appeal to those prioritizing unique gifts over mass retail. The intimate atmosphere suits browsing and discovery.​

For Creative Hands-On Engagement: Mid Valley's Santa's Academy and Sunway Velocity's workshop emphasize providing comprehensive activity options sustaining multiple-hour visits. Ideal for families with children aged 5–14.​

For Budget-Conscious Celebration: Free-admission mall browsing (Pavilion, Suria KLCC) combined with Christmas markets (Lot 10, Kozie) and workshops (Sunway Velocity) enables comprehensive festive engagement without premium pricing.​
